服务器灰点平衡什么意思
-
服务器灰点平衡是指在服务器集群中,通过调度算法将负载均匀地分配给各个服务器,以实现服务器资源的最优化利用。
在一个服务器集群中,每台服务器都承担着处理客户端请求和提供服务的任务。但是由于不同的服务器配置和实际负载情况的差异,可能会导致某些服务器承担了过多的负载,而其他服务器负载较轻。
为了解决这个问题,服务器灰点平衡算法被引入。该算法通过监控服务器的负载情况并实时调整负载分配,使得集群中的每台服务器承担的负载尽可能接近平衡。这样可以避免某些服务器负载过重而导致性能下降,同时也能充分利用集群中每台服务器的资源,提高整个系统的吞吐量和稳定性。
服务器灰点平衡算法的核心思想是根据各个服务器的负载情况动态调整负载。常用的调度算法包括轮询算法、加权轮询算法、最小连接数算法等。这些算法根据服务器的处理能力、负载情况等因素来决定将客户端请求转发给哪台服务器。通过合理选择调度算法并结合实时监测和统计信息,可以实现负载均衡的效果。
服务器灰点平衡对于提升服务器集群的性能、增强系统的可靠性和稳定性有着重要的作用。它能够避免单个服务器过载而导致系统崩溃,同时还能减少资源浪费,提高整体的处理能力。因此,在设计和管理服务器集群时,合理配置和使用灰点平衡算法是十分重要的。
1年前 -
服务器灰点平衡是指在服务器负载均衡中的一种策略。为了提高服务器的性能和可用性,通常会使用负载均衡技术来将请求分配给多个服务器进行处理。而服务器灰点平衡是在负载均衡过程中,根据服务器的当前状态对请求进行分配的一种算法。
具体来说,服务器灰点平衡考虑了服务器当前的负载情况,以及一些其他的因素,如服务器的健康状况、网络状况等。根据这些信息,将请求分配给合适的服务器,以实现负载均衡。
以下是服务器灰点平衡的一些特点和意义:
-
考虑服务器的实际负载情况:服务器灰点平衡不仅仅考虑服务器的负载量,还考虑到了服务器的实际负载情况。例如,某个服务器上的某个应用程序可能正在进行一些计算密集型的任务,而另一个服务器可能没有这样的负载。在这种情况下,服务器灰点平衡会优先将请求分配给负载较轻的服务器,以保持整体性能的均衡。
-
考虑服务器的健康状况:服务器灰点平衡还可以考虑服务器的健康状况。如果某个服务器发生了故障或者出现了其他的问题,服务器灰点平衡会将请求分配给其他正常的服务器,以防止出现单点故障。
-
提高系统的可用性:通过服务器灰点平衡,可以将请求均匀地分配给多个服务器,从而提高系统的可用性。即使一个或多个服务器发生故障,其他的服务器仍然可以正常工作,不会影响整个系统的运行。
-
降低服务器的负载:通过服务器灰点平衡,可以避免某个服务器被过度负载,从而提高系统的整体性能。当某个服务器的负载达到一定阈值时,服务器灰点平衡会将请求分配给其他服务器,以降低负载。
-
优化用户体验:服务器灰点平衡可以根据用户的需求和实际情况,将请求分配给最适合的服务器。这样可以提高用户的访问速度和体验,让用户感觉到系统的响应速度更快。
1年前 -
-
服务器负载均衡是指将网络流量、应用程序或请求合理地分配到多台服务器上,以提高系统的性能、可靠性和可扩展性。服务器负载均衡可以平衡服务器的负载,使各个服务器能够平均分担请求,避免单台服务器负载过重导致性能下降或服务器宕机的问题。
服务器负载均衡可以通过多种方法来实现,其中一种常用的方法是灰度发布。灰度发布是指在生产环境中逐渐将新版本或新功能引入,对部分用户或部分请求进行测试和验证,以减少潜在的风险。在服务器负载均衡中,灰度发布可以通过控制流量的分发,逐步将流量从旧服务器转移到新服务器上,确保新服务器的稳定性和性能。
下面是服务器灰度平衡的操作流程:
-
准备新的服务器:首先,需要准备好一台或多台新的服务器,配置好操作系统、网络和软件环境,并确保新服务器的可用性和性能。
-
配置负载均衡器:根据实际情况,选择一种可靠的负载均衡器,例如Nginx、HAProxy等,并进行配置。负载均衡器可以根据不同的算法来分配流量,例如轮询、加权轮询、最少连接等。配置负载均衡器时,需要将新服务器添加到负载均衡器的服务器池中。
-
测试流量分发:在进行灰度发布之前,需要测试负载均衡器的流量分发功能。可以通过模拟用户请求或者实际的真实流量来进行测试。测试时,可以观察流量是否均匀地分发到各个服务器上,是否按照配置的算法进行分发。
-
开始灰度发布:一旦测试通过,可以开始进行灰度发布。根据实际需要,可以选择将部分用户或部分请求流量引导到新服务器上。可以使用一些技术手段,例如通过用户IP、浏览器标识、URL参数等来控制流量的分发。
-
监控和调优:在灰度发布期间,需要密切监控新服务器的性能和稳定性。可以使用监控工具来监测服务器的负载、连接数、响应时间等指标,并及时进行调优和优化。如果发现新服务器存在性能问题或不稳定,可以暂停流量分发,进行故障排查和修复。
-
完成灰度发布:当新服务器经过一段时间的稳定运行后,可以逐渐增加流量分发到新服务器,最终将所有流量都平衡地分配到新服务器和旧服务器上。一旦完成灰度发布,可以将新服务器作为正式的生产服务器,停止旧服务器的使用。
通过灰度发布实现服务器负载均衡可以提高系统的性能和可靠性,并提供更好的用户体验。但需要注意的是,灰度发布需要根据实际情况进行合理的规划和操作,避免影响正常的业务运行。
1年前 -